Effects of Collaborative Pair-Programming on Novices’ Learning to Program Using Alice
This study aimed to examine how collaborative pair-programming and type of goal-orientation feedback affect novices’ programming performance and attitude after a 36-hour experimental learning activity using Alice.The preliminary analysis suggested that (1) the collaborative pair-programming group performed as well as the control group (the individual group) on Alice programming performance; (2) the mastery-feedback group outperformed the performance- feedback group on basic concepts but performed the at the same level on advanced concepts; (3) the masteryfeedback group showed higher degree of acceptance toward learning than the performance-feedback group; and (4) the collaborative pair-programming group perceived higher degree of attitude in the usefulness aspect toward the received learning activity than the control group.
